The Celestial Emu: A Milky Way Spectacle Over Boonwurrung Country
This incredible 3-shot vertorama, captured at a 17mm focal length, showcases the majestic rising Milky Way over Tannahan, also known as Cape Schanck, on Boonwurrung Country. The scene was framed during a retreating tide, adding to the tranquil beauty of the night.
A Sky Painted with Stars
The Sagittarius Star Cloud shone exceptionally bright, cutting through the subtle green airglow. What makes this image truly captivating is the prominence of the "Great Rift," a dark dust lane within the Milky Way that remarkably forms the shape of an emu. This celestial emu was particularly noticeable against the darkness, creating a stunning visual narrative in the night sky.
Technical Details
This breathtaking shot was achieved using a Sony A7III camera paired with a Tamron 17-28mm lens at 17mm. The exposure settings were a 20-second shutter speed at ISO 5000, with the aperture set to f/2.8, allowing ample light to capture the intricate details of the galaxy.
